Objective

By the end of this 15-minute lesson, 1st grade students will be able to identify and use basic Spanish vocabulary related to family members, school items, and clothing through completing fill-in-the-gap sentences. Materials

  • Whiteboard and markers
  • Printed Spanish vocabulary worksheet (provided below; one per student)
  • Picture cards representing family members, school items, and clothing
  • Stickers or small rewards for participation

Lesson Procedures

1. Warm-Up (3 minutes)

  • Greet students in Spanish using simple phrases (e.g., "¡Hola! ¿Cómo estás?") to build a welcoming language atmosphere.
  • Show picture cards one by one (family member, school item, clothing). Say the word in Spanish and have students repeat chorally.
  • Example words: madre, padre, escuela, libro, camisa, zapatos.

2. Vocabulary Introduction and Modeling (4 minutes)

  • Write 3 words under each category on the whiteboard with corresponding images.
  • Say each word, have students repeat, then use each word in a simple sentence in English and Spanish (e.g., "This is a libro. Libro means book.")
  • Emphasize pronunciation and letter sounds.

3. Guided Practice: Fill-the-Gap Worksheet (6 minutes)

  • Hand out the worksheet with sentences in Spanish with blanks for family, school, and clothing vocabulary.
  • Read each sentence aloud slowly, and ask students to repeat after you. Then have students fill in the blanks individually.
  • Walk around and assist students as needed, encouraging them to use the context of sentences.

4. Review and Wrap-Up (2 minutes)

  • Select 3-4 students to read their filled sentences aloud in Spanish.
  • Give positive feedback and reinforce vocabulary by pointing to images or the words on the board.

Assessment

  • Informal through observation of student participation and accuracy in the worksheet.
  • Listening to individual student reading of filled sentences to assess pronunciation and comprehension.

Worksheet: Vocabulario Familiar, Escuela, y Ropa

Instrucciones: Llena los espacios en blanco con la palabra correcta de la lista. Escoge palabras sobre la familia, la escuela, o la ropa.

Lista de palabras:
madre, padre, escuela, libro, lápiz, camisa, zapatos, hermano, mochila


  1. Mi _______ es muy simpático.
  2. En la _______ aprendemos cosas nuevas.
  3. Me pongo una _______ azul hoy.
  4. Uso un _______ para escribir.
  5. Mi _______ tiene una mochila roja.
  6. Mis _______ son grandes y blancos.
  7. Mi _______ es mi amigo.
  8. Él lee un _______ interesante.
  9. Mi _______ trabaja mucho.

Teachers: Encourage students to say each completed sentence aloud and use the vocabulary words in simple spoken sentences during follow-up lessons to deepen retention.
